TRK Fusion Cancer Overview
Tropomyosin receptor kinase (TRK) is family of three neurotrophic receptor tyrosine kinase proteins (TRKA, TRKB, and TRKC) encoded by the NTRK1, NTRK2, and NTRK3 genes located on chromosomes 1q23.1, 9q21.33, and 15q25.3, respectively.

Turning Point Therapeutics is developing Repotrectinib for the treatment of NTRK+ solid cancers. It is an orally administered tyrosine kinase inhibitor being evaluated in an ongoing phase I/II trial called TRIDENT-1 for both TKI-naïve and TKI-pretreated patients with ROS1+ advanced NSCLC and ROS1+, NTRK+ or ALK+ advanced solid tumors. It was designed to efficiently bind with the active kinase conformation and avoid steric interference from a variety of clinically resistant mutations.
TRK Fusion Cancer Diagnosis
The diagnosis of this gene fusion can be identified by various approaches, including fluorescent in situ hybridization, reverse transcription-polymerase chain reaction, immunohistochemistry, next-generation sequencing, and ribonucleic acid-based multiplexed assays.
TRK Fusion Cancer Therapy
The targeted precision therapy is now one of the emerging approaches to treat various cancers based on the specific genetic alternation identified in them. Recently, Rozlytrek and Vitrakvi are approved for the treatment of solid tumors with NTRK gene fusion. The US FDA has also granted them priority review, breakthrough therapy designation and orphan product designation.
TRK Fusion Cancer Treatment
With the advancement in genetic testing, cases of TRK fusion cancer is more common among various cancer types. Progress in the understanding of TRK family biology with the growing recognition of TRK fusion in various cancers has fueled interest in the development of small-molecule inhibitors of TRK. Now, companies are also focusing on precision medicines. Two breakthroughs in the treatment of TRK fusion cancer is the recent approval of larotrectinib (Vitrakvi) and entrectinib (Rozlytrek). Moreover, various TRK inhibitors are also in clinical stages of development.
